关于
案例
资讯
联系我们
购买
本凡·本不平凡
商城小程序解决方案的全景视角

本凡(武汉) 责任编辑:IT 发布时间:2026-06-02

在当今数字化经济的浪潮中,商城小程序的重要性愈发凸显。无论您是一个新兴的电商企业,还是一个已经在市场上拥有一定知名度的品牌,都会发现,拥有一个高效、便捷的小程序不仅能提升用户体验,还能显著提高销售额。商城小程序解决方案的具体过程是怎样的呢?本文将详细介绍这一过程,从需求分析到最终部署,每一个环节都不会遗漏。

一、需求分析

在开始商城小程序开发之前,最重要的一步是需求分析。这不仅是为了确保开发出的小程序符合企业的实际需求,还能为后续的开发和维护提供重要的参考依据。

市场调研需要对市场进行深入调研。了解目标用户的需求、竞争对手的特点以及市场的整体趋势。这一步能帮助企业明确自己的定位和目标用户群体。

功能需求根据市场调研的结果,详细列出小程序需要具备的功能。常见的功能包括用户注册登录、商品展示、购物车、支付、订单管理、用户评价等。这些功能需求将成为后续开发的基础。

技术需求需求分析还包括技术方面的要求,比如小程序的性能、安全性、可扩展性等。这些技术需求将影响到后续的开发选型和架构设计。

预算与时间在功能和技术需求确定之后,需要制定一个详细的预算和时间计划。这包括开发费用、人力资源配置、项目进度等。

二、设计与开发

一旦需求分析完成,我们就可以进入设计与开发阶段。这一阶段是整个项目的核心,涉及到界面设计、后端开发、前端开发等多个环节。

UI设计UI设计是商城小程序的第一印象,好的设计能够吸引用户,增加用户粘性。设计师需要根据用户调研结果,制定一个美观、易用的界面设计方案。这包括首页、商品展示页、购物车、支付页等多个部分。

架构设计架构设计决定了小程序的整体结构和数据流。需要设计好数据库、服务器、接口等各个部分的关系。这一阶段的重点在于确保系统的可扩展性和稳定性。

前端开发前端开发是将设计稿转化为实际的小程序界面。这包括HTML、CSS、JavaScript等前端技术的应用。开发人员需要确保小程序在不同设备上的表现一致,并且加载速度快。

后端开发后端开发则涉及到数据的存储、处理和安全问题。需要开发服务器端的各个功能模块,包括用户管理、商品管理、订单管理、支付接口等。还需要设计好与前端的接口,确保数据的同步和准确。

测试与优化在开发完成后,进行全面的测试,包括功能测试、性能测试、安全测试等。通过测试发现并修复各种可能的问题,确保小程序在实际使用中的稳定性和安全性。测试后,对小程序进行优化,提升加载速度和用户体验。

三、部署与维护

开发和测试完成后,小程序需要进行部署和上线。上线后还需要进行长期的维护和更新,以应对市场变化和用户需求。

部署部署包括服务器配置、数据库部署、小程序上线等。需要确保服务器能够承受预期的流量,数据库能够高效处理查询和写入操作。将小程序上传到微信小程序平台进行审核和上线。

上线与推广上线后,需要进行推广,吸引用户下载和使用小程序。可以通过各种渠道进行推广,比如微信公众号、微信朋友圈、社交媒体等。需要及时处理用户反馈,优化小程序。

数据分析与改进通过数据分析工具,对小程序的使用情况进行监控和分析。根据数据分析结果,不断改进和优化小程序,提升用户体验和销售业绩。

持续维护商城小程序的开发并不是一成不变的,需要根据市场变化和用户需求进行持续的维护和更新。包括功能的增加、bug的修复、界面的优化等。

通过以上详细的介绍,您应该对商城小程序解决方案的全过程有了一个全面的了解。从需求分析到最终部署,每一个环节都至关重要。希望本文能够为您在开发商城小程序的过程中提供有价值的参考和帮助。

在商城小程序开发的实际操作中,每一个环节都需要细致入微,以确保最终的产品能够满足市场需求,并为企业带来预期的商业价值。本文将继续深入探讨商城小程序解决方案的具体过程,从具体实现到实际案例分析,帮助您更全面地理解这一过程。

一、具体实现

在商城小程序解决方案的具体实现阶段,我们需要结合前面的需求分析和设计,将各个模块进行实际编码和实现。

前端实现前端开发是将UI设计转化为实际的小程序界面。开发人员需要使用微信小程序的官方开发框架和API,编写小程序的各个界面。这包括首页、商品列表、商品详情、购物车、支付页面等。开发人员需要特别注意小程序的加载速度和用户体验,以确保界面的流畅性2.后端实现后端开发则涉及到数据的存储、处理和安全问题。

这一阶段需要开发人员使用相应的编程语言和框架,比如Node.js、Python等,搭建服务器,并设计好数据库的架构。常见的数据库有MySQL、MongoDB等。需要开发服务器端的各个功能模块,包括用户管理、商品管理、订单管理、支付接口等,并确保数据与前端的接口同步准确。

接口设计前后端需要通过接口进行数据交互。这些接口需要设计得足够灵活,以便于后续功能的扩展和维护。常见的接口类型包括RESTfulAPI和GraphQL等。接口设计需要特别注意安全性,防止数据泄露和恶意攻击。

安全性在开发过程中,安全性是一个不可忽视的重要问题。需要采取多种措施来保护用户数据和系统安全,比如数据加密、身份验证、防止SQL注入等。特别是在支付功能上,需要遵循PCI-DSS等安全标准,确保支付过程的安全性。

二、测试与优化

开发完成后,进行全面的测试是确保小程序质量和稳定性的关键步骤。

功能测试功能测试是针对各个功能模块进行的测试,确保每个功能都按照设计要求正常运行。测试内容包括用户注册登录、商品搜索、购物车加减、订单支付等。

性能测试性能测试是为了评估小程序在高并发情况下的表现,确保系统的响应速度和稳定性。可以使用工具如JMeter进行压力测试,模拟大量用户同时访问系统。

安全测试安全测试是为了发现系统中的安全漏洞,确保数据和系统的安全性。常见的安全测试方法包括渗透测试、安全漏洞扫描等。

用户体验测试用户体验测试是为了评估小程序的界面设计和交互效果,确保用户能够轻松使用系统。可以通过用户调研、可用性测试等方式进行评估。

优化根据测试结果,对小程序进行优化,包括界面优化、性能优化、功能优化等。优化的目的是提升用户体验和系统性能。

三、部署与上线

部署和上线是整个开发过程的最后一步,确保小程序能够在实际环境中正常运行。

服务器配置需要配置服务器,确保服务器能够承受预期的流量。选择合适的服务器类型和配置,根据流量情况进行扩展。

数据库部署部署数据库,确保数据能够高效地存储和查询。根据业务需求选择合适的数据库类型和存储方案。

代码上传将开发完成的代码上传到服务器,并进行必要的配置和调试。

微信小程序上线将小程序上传到微信小程序平台,进行审核。审核通过后,小程序就可以正式上线。

四、推广与维护

上线后,需要进行推广,吸引用户下载和使用小程序。需要进行长期的维护和更新,以应对市场变化和用户需求。

推广可以通过多种渠道进行推广,比如微信公众号、微信朋友圈、社交媒体等。可以通过优惠活动、用户评价等方式吸引用户下载和使用小程序。

数据分析通过数据分析工具,对小程序的使用情况进行监控和分析。分析数据可以帮助发现用户的痛点和需求,为后续的优化和改进提供依据。

用户反馈及时处理用户反馈,收集用户的意见和建议,并根据反馈进行改进和优化。

持续维护商城小程序的开发并不是一成不变的,需要根据市场变化和用户需求进行持续的维护和更新。包括功能的增加、bug的修复、界面的优化等。

通过以上详细的介绍,您应该对商城小程序解决方案的具体实现过程有了一个全面的了解。从具体实现到实际案例分析,每一个环节都需要细致入微,以确保最终的产品能够满足市场需求,并为企业带来预期的商业价值。希望本文能够为您在开发商城小程序的过程中提供有价值的参考和帮助。

分享到:
更多资讯